Hong Kong – Hong Kong doubles funding for 5G subsidy scheme to HKS$100 million (Global Times)

The Hong Kong SAR government has increased the funding for a subsidy scheme to encourage early 5G development, with the funding increased from HK$50 million ($6.44 million) to HK$100 million, according to a post on the official website of the Hong Kong SAR government on Sunday.
